What is the Dry Density — Light Compaction Test?

The Standard Proctor Compaction Test (Light Compaction) determines the relationship between water content and dry density of soil under a standard compaction effort of 2.6 kJ/m³. Soil is compacted in a 1000ml mould using a 2.6kg rammer dropped from 310mm height in 3 layers, 25 blows per layer. The test produces a compaction curve (dry density vs water content) whose peak defines OMC and MDD.

Conducted as per IS 2720 Part 7, the Standard Proctor test is the most widely used compaction reference in India for roads, embankments, backfill and earthworks. The MDD and OMC are used to specify the required field compaction — typically 95–100% of MDD — and as the basis for field density acceptance per IS 2720 Part 28 (sand replacement method).

How the Dry Density — Light Compaction Test is Conducted

  • 1
    Sample Preparation
    Soil sieved through 20mm sieve. Approximately 3kg soil prepared for each of 5 test points at different water contents.
  • 2
    Compaction
    Soil compacted in 1000ml mould in 3 equal layers, 25 blows per layer with 2.6kg rammer falling 310mm.
  • 3
    Water Content Measurement
    Representative sample from each compacted specimen dried in oven at 105°C for moisture content.
  • 4
    Dry Density Calculation
    Bulk density = mass of compacted soil / mould volume. Dry density = bulk density / (1 + w/100).
  • 5
    OMC, MDD & Report
    Dry density vs water content plotted. OMC and MDD read from peak of curve. NABL report within 3 days.

Applicable Test Standards

Standard Title Scope Type
IS 2720 Part 7 Methods of Test for Soils — Determination of Water Content-Dry Density Relation (Light Compaction) Standard Proctor Indian Standard
IS 2720 Part 28 Methods of Test for Soils — Determination of Dry Density by Sand Replacement Field Density Indian Standard
IRC 36 Recommended Practice for Construction of Earth Embankments for Road Works Highway Earthwork IRC
ASTM D698 Standard Test Methods for Laboratory Compaction Characteristics of Soil — Standard Effort Standard Proctor ASTM

Where is the Dry Density — Light Compaction Test Used?

Highway embankment compaction specification for NHAI and state PWD
Subgrade compaction reference for flexible and rigid pavement construction
Backfill compaction specification for retaining walls, culverts and pipe trenches
Earth dam and levee compaction design and quality control
Industrial floor slab subgrade compaction acceptance testing
Earthwork specification for housing development and urban infrastructure projects
